Handover — Vexler partner SFTP drop

Ownership moves to you today. Drop runs hourly from Vexler's end into the intake bucket via the relay host. Watch for zero-byte files; their exporter flakes on Mondays. Creds live in the ops vault, path noted in the runbook. Vault auto-seals after 48h idle. Support escalations go to the on-call rotation, not me. If the vault is sealed when you need it, unseal with the recovery passphrase below.

recovery phrase for tadug-fafof: zorwyn-kasion

## Changed defaults — health checks (v4.2)

Starting with this release, the Corvane ingress service behind the Nimblepool load balancer uses stricter health check defaults: shorter intervals, a lower unhealthy threshold, and a dedicated readiness endpoint instead of the root path. Please read the reasoning in the design note before overriding anything. The new default configuration values are listed below.

service settings:
quenath:
  log_level: info
  metrics_host: metrics.quenath.tolvaqlabs.internal
  pin: 1407
  pool_size: 8

## Service Accounts — Config Hot-Reload (Pinwheel)

The Pinwheel config service pushes changes to running pods without restarts. Each consumer uses a dedicated service account; do not share accounts across environments. Reloads are signed, and unsigned payloads are rejected. Watch intervals default to 15s; override in the manifest only with team approval. Contractors get read-only accounts scoped to staging. The `pinwheel-reloader` account authenticates to the internal signing endpoint on every push cycle. Its current key is below.

service key, kaduf-bawig: kto15_Ze79S0dligTw0yO

Handover note — Crumbwheel order cutoffs.

Welcome aboard. The bakery cutoff rule in Crumbwheel closes same-day orders at 14:00 local to each storefront, not UTC — this has bitten us twice. Holiday overrides live in the calendar service and take precedence silently, so always check there first when a cutoff looks wrong. To unlock the calendar service's admin console after a restart, enter the recovery passphrase below.

vault phrase of bagap-bahaf = silion-pelox-sorox-casdor-quenwyn-fraax-eliox-praael-kelion-quenvan-kasox-rusael-norius-belvan